Setting Goals for Personal Growth


Setting clear and achievable goals is the first step towards personal growth. Here are some strategies to help women define their objectives:


SMART Goals


Using the SMART criteria can help in setting effective goals:


  • Specific: Clearly define what you want to achieve.

  • Measurable: Establish criteria to measure progress.

  • Achievable: Set realistic goals that challenge you but are attainable.

  • Relevant: Ensure your goals align with your values and long-term vision.

  • Time-bound: Set a deadline to create urgency.


Example of a SMART Goal


Instead of saying, "I want to be healthier," a SMART goal would be: "I will exercise for 30 minutes, five times a week for the next three months."

Emotional Intelligence


Emotional intelligence (EQ) is the ability to understand and manage emotions. Women can improve their EQ by:


  • Practicing mindfulness: Techniques such as meditation can help in recognizing and regulating emotions.

  • Seeking feedback: Engaging with trusted friends or mentors can provide insights into emotional responses and behaviors.

Imposter Syndrome


Many women experience imposter syndrome, doubting their accomplishments. To combat this:


  • Acknowledge achievements: Keep a journal of successes to remind yourself of your capabilities.

  • Share experiences: Discussing feelings of inadequacy with trusted friends can help normalize these feelings and provide support.
